Academic Achievements
  • Received an ERC Starting Grant worth 1.5 million Euro; published multiple papers such as 'Haptic Redirection: Modulating Hand Movement Speed with Vibrotactile Feedback'.
Research Experience
  • Leads the Sensorimotor Interaction group (senSInt) at the Max Planck Institute for Informatics, co-located with the Human Computer Interaction Lab of Saarland University.
Background
  • Research interests include Tactile Rendering, Sensorimotor Augmentation, and On-Body Systems. Focuses on improving Human Computer Interaction through enhancing human perception and computer sensing.
